Iron Ore Fines are defined as iron ore dust with the majority of individual particles measuring less than 4.75 millimeters (3/16 inch) diameter. We offer high quality Iron Ore fines in different grades according to the requirements of our clients.

Iron ore is the source of primary iron for the world's iron and steel industries. It is therefore essential for the production of steel, which in turn is essential to maintain a strong industrial base. Almost all (98%) iron ore is used in steelmaking. Iron ore is mined in about 50 countries. The seven largest of these producing countries account for about three-quarters of total world production. Australia and Brazil together dominate the world's iron ore exports, each having about one-third of total exports
